Eugene Burroughs has moved from an assistant role on the 76ers' coaching staff to the head job with their D-League affiliate, the Delaware 87ers.
Burroughs is a Philadelphia native who went to high school at Episcopal Academy. For the last two NBA seasons, he was the 76ers' shooting coach. Before then, he worked on college staffs at Penn State, Marist, Navy, Hofstra and American University.
The move from the Wells Fargo Center to Newark is part of a swap of coaches between the Sixers and the Sevens. Kevin Young, Delaware's head coach for the last two seasons, will come to Philadelphia to work as an assistant.
